ez bypass for tailgate wiring sought 200 1983

Morning,

This tailgating thing is really getting out of hand...kind of like watergate for the new millenium?

Humor is weak, too early.

Wiper/sprayer out on rear of 245, can live with that. Don't need clear view of nimrod on my tail.

Lock tied into central locking dysfunctional, can live with that, thing still locks manually.

Unfortunately license plate lights are out now as well, that could cause a problem w/ constable.

Looking at hinges from exterior w/door closed, all wires in both hinges are broken 100% through.

Do I really need to replace both harnesses through both hinges to get the lights to work back there?

How are they wired, one light from left, other from right (harness)?

How bout the ground--I understand the struts that hold up the door have s.thing to do w/ proper ground for everything back there.

Is my first (Volvo) wagon, thanks for any advice, this could get weird.
